Haha, another awesome job Bloodrun. It is very easily customisable, only problem I have is when I'm posting a news comment, for some reason I get an error if the detail field is too long. I have to go into the database and manually edit it. Any idea why?
 
Saphira said:
Haha, another awesome job Bloodrun. It is very easily customisable, only problem I have is when I'm posting a news comment, for some reason I get an error if the detail field is too long. I have to go into the database and manually edit it. Any idea why?

Hmm in your database, go to your 'adopts_news' table and change the details type to longtext.

That should take care of the text limitation.
